基本信息来源于合作网站,原文需代理用户跳转至来源网站获取       
摘要:
提出了一种基于程序功能标签切片的制导符号执行分析方法OPT-SSE.该方法从程序功能文档提取功能标签,利用程序控制流分析,建立各功能标签和程序基本块的映射关系,并根据功能标签在程序执行中的顺序关系生成功能标签执行流.针对给定的代码目标点,提取与之相关的功能执行流切片,根据预定义好的功能标签流制导规则进行符号执行分析,在路径分析过程中,及时裁剪无关的功能分支路径以提升制导效率.通过对不同的功能标签流进行分离制导符号执行分析,可避免一直执行某复杂循环体的情形,从而提高对目标程序的整体分支覆盖率和指令覆盖率.实验结果表明,通过对binutils、gzip、coreutils等10个不同软件中的20个应用工具上的分析,OPT-SSE与KLEE提供的主流搜索策略相比,代码目标制导速度平均提升到4.238倍,代码目标制导成功率平均提升了31%,程序指令覆盖率平均提升了8.95%,程序分支覆盖率平均提升了8.28%.
推荐文章
基于混合符号执行的Fuzzing测试技术
混合符号执行
动态插桩
Fuzzing测试
约束求解
代码覆盖率
基于动态符号执行的二进制程序缺陷发现系统
语义提取
动态符号执行
路径调度
二进制程序缺陷发现
一种JAVA程序静态切片的方法
JAVA程序
程序切片
系统依赖图
内容分析
关键词云
关键词热度
相关文献总数  
(/次)
(/年)
文献信息
篇名 一种基于程序功能标签切片的制导符号执行分析方法
来源期刊 软件学报 学科 工学
关键词 制导符号执行 分支覆盖率 指令覆盖率 搜索策略 程序切片
年,卷(期) 2019,(11) 所属期刊栏目 系统软件与软件工程
研究方向 页码范围 3259-3280
页数 22页 分类号 TP311
字数 15015字 语种 中文
DOI 10.13328/j.cnki.jos.005562
五维指标
作者信息
序号 姓名 单位 发文数 被引次数 H指数 G指数
1 谢向辉 44 95 5.0 8.0
2 甘水滔 5 19 2.0 4.0
3 陈左宁 5 28 3.0 5.0
4 秦晓军 4 19 2.0 4.0
5 周林 2 4 2.0 2.0
传播情况
(/次)
(/年)
引文网络
引文网络
二级参考文献  (29)
共引文献  (17)
参考文献  (17)
节点文献
引证文献  (2)
同被引文献  (4)
二级引证文献  (3)
1976(2)
  • 参考文献(1)
  • 二级参考文献(1)
1990(3)
  • 参考文献(1)
  • 二级参考文献(2)
1996(1)
  • 参考文献(0)
  • 二级参考文献(1)
1999(1)
  • 参考文献(0)
  • 二级参考文献(1)
2003(1)
  • 参考文献(0)
  • 二级参考文献(1)
2005(2)
  • 参考文献(1)
  • 二级参考文献(1)
2007(1)
  • 参考文献(0)
  • 二级参考文献(1)
2009(4)
  • 参考文献(1)
  • 二级参考文献(3)
2010(3)
  • 参考文献(1)
  • 二级参考文献(2)
2011(2)
  • 参考文献(0)
  • 二级参考文献(2)
2012(7)
  • 参考文献(4)
  • 二级参考文献(3)
2013(3)
  • 参考文献(3)
  • 二级参考文献(0)
2014(4)
  • 参考文献(3)
  • 二级参考文献(1)
2015(6)
  • 参考文献(2)
  • 二级参考文献(4)
2016(2)
  • 参考文献(0)
  • 二级参考文献(2)
2017(1)
  • 参考文献(0)
  • 二级参考文献(1)
2018(1)
  • 参考文献(0)
  • 二级参考文献(1)
2019(2)
  • 参考文献(0)
  • 二级参考文献(2)
2019(3)
  • 参考文献(0)
  • 二级参考文献(2)
  • 引证文献(1)
  • 二级引证文献(0)
2019(1)
  • 引证文献(1)
  • 二级引证文献(0)
2020(4)
  • 引证文献(1)
  • 二级引证文献(3)
研究主题发展历程
节点文献
制导符号执行
分支覆盖率
指令覆盖率
搜索策略
程序切片
研究起点
研究来源
研究分支
研究去脉
引文网络交叉学科
相关学者/机构
期刊影响力
软件学报
月刊
1000-9825
11-2560/TP
16开
北京8718信箱
82-367
1990
chi
出版文献量(篇)
5820
总下载数(次)
36
相关基金
国家自然科学基金
英文译名:the National Natural Science Foundation of China
官方网址:http://www.nsfc.gov.cn/
项目类型:青年科学基金项目(面上项目)
学科类型:数理科学
论文1v1指导